Tesla, accused of trademark infringement in China, was indicted

According to Bloomberg reports, Tesla Motors was sued for trademark infringement in China, while Chinese traders accounted for the registration of Tesla trademark before the U.S. electric car giant entered the Chinese market. Bloomberg quoted his petition filed in Beijing on July 3 saying that Zhan Bao Sheng asked Tesla to close its motor showrooms, service centers and pressurization facilities in China; stop all sales and marketing activities in China; and pay him 23.9 million yuan of compensation.

The Daily Economic News reporter found on the website of China Trademark that the applicant owns a total of 7 registrations under the name of Po Sang, including TESLA MOTORS, TELSA, TESLA, TESLA, Tesla and others. Among them, TESLA Application, registration number is 5588947, the international classification number is 12 (cars, trucks, motorcycles, etc.), a special period of 10 years. The public information shows that Tesla Motors was established in 2003.

The reporters also found that Loremo, Cobasys and Cuill are also included in the registered trademarks of Pompeii, while Loremo is a German car company with the same name as the three trademarks, Cobasys is a US car battery supplier, and Cuill is a search engine Engine, created by former Google employees.

Bloomberg quoted Tesla spokesman Simon Sproule as saying that the company has not received or seen the petition and that the prosecution of Po Sang will never stop Tesla from operating in China.

According to Netease Technology and Sina Finance, last year, relevant regulatory authorities had ruled that the trademark infringement on behalf of Pou Sheng was invalid. This time, the claims submitted by Bao Sheng need to be overturned before the ruling can be carried out.

Reporter noted that accounting Bao Bao took an interview with Sina Automotive said that "the court has accepted my lawsuit, my lawsuit request Bloomberg did not state that the first claim is actually a trademark dispute, the second claim is infringement , That is, ask Tesla to pay me 23.9 million yuan. "

The relevant departments in China ruled that its trademark invalid, accounted for Po Sang said, "Trademark disputes are generally hit the Trademark Office from the Trademark Office, without reconciliation and the like will hit the Intermediate People's Court or even the High People's Court, the final verdict did not come out Tesla's trademark was still in my hands. "
